The baby’s practice cries include imitating the breathing ... WebJul 27, 2024 · What can your baby hear in the womb? As well as the muted sounds of the outside world and your heartbeat, they'll also be able to hear any noises from your digestive system. It is believed the clearest noise your baby will be able to hear is your voice (yay!) as the sound of it reverberates through your bones and your body which amplifies it.

WebHow can I bond with my baby in the womb? Ways to bond with your baby during pregnancy. Talk and sing to your baby, knowing he or she can hear you. Gently touch and rub your belly, or massage it. Respond to your baby’s kicks. Play music to your baby. Give yourself time to reflect, go for a walk or have a warm bath and think about the baby. Between 16 and 22 weeks of pregnancy, your baby may start to hear faint sounds inside your body such as the noise made by your breathing, heartbeat, and digestion. These sounds will grow louder as your baby's hearing improves. After 23 weeks, your baby can hear sounds from the outside world, including … See more Your baby's ears start developing in the first weeks of pregnancy, and aren't fully formed until the third trimester. The ear is a remarkably complex organ, with three separate parts (the … See more The noises and voices your baby hears from the outside world sound muffled.
